Culture:Chinese
Title:soup plate
Date Made:1740-1750
Type:Food Service
Materials:ceramic: hard paste porcelain, overglaze polychrome enamels, gilding. Brownish underglaze enamel rim.
Place Made:China; Jingdezhen
Measurements:overall: 9 in.; 22.86 cm
Accession Number:  HD 13-W
Museum Collection:  Historic Deerfield
13-Wf.jpg

Description:
Chinese export porcelain scalloped soup plate in rose, blue, iron red, purple, yellow, green, turquoise, white, and black enamels and gilding with a crysthanthemum bouquet in blue cornocopia-like flourish. Around the top of cavetto, scrolled band of gilt (now gone) edged in iron red. Rim decoration is rose and gilt rocaillerie, rose blossoms, and gilt leaves. Edge is scrolled moulded with a gilt band. Brownish underglaze enamel along flared edge.
